Old Republic Surety Company (ORSC) is currently seeking a Contract Underwriter to join its Underwriting Team at our Dallas, TX branch. ORSC ranks among the nation's top underwriters of contractors' performance and payment bonds, miscellaneous surety, and commercial fidelity, offering thousands of types of bonds. In general, under the guidance of a marketing and/or underwriting manager, the Contract Underwriter analyzes all relevant information on bond renewals and submissions and underwrites within authority limit or recommends underwriting decisions to the manager.
Essential duties for the role are as follows:

  • Underwrite bonds within authority limit, and/or make underwriting recommendations to management that will contribute to the Company profitability objective.
  • Develop and apply financial analysis and underwriting skills which lead to acceptable loss ratio objective.
  • Demonstrate proficiency in applying Company underwriting procedures and policies.
  • Participate in regular travel of the assigned territory by use of motor vehicle (personal, rental and/or company provided), public transportation and/or airplane. Travel is including, but not limited to, attending agency visits to maintain current business and/or obtain additional business, participating in industry specific events, and meeting with prospective business partners.
  • Develop and maintain rapport with agency plant and service agents to enhance marketing efforts.
  • Collaborate with other Company employees to promote efficient and effective underwriting services to agents.
  • Enter information and maintain the agency database utilizing Customer Relationship Management (CRM) software to assist in the marketing growth objectives of the respective branch and/or home office. Utilize data to grow business
  • Other duties as assigned.

This position requires a High School diploma, or equivalent, and a minimum of 18 months bond industry or related experience, or an equivalent combination of education and experience.

Working as an Contract Underwriterrequires one to work independently and effectively within a fast-paced environment. Proficiency with Microsoft (MS) Windows and Office products is necessary. Other skills necessary include excellent oral and written communication skills, strong organizational and accurate proofreading skills, the ability to maintain accurate records, the ability to exercise discretion with confidential information, strong attention to detail, and the ability to use a variety of office equipment.
